x
5

Work From Home New Development Jobs

Permanent Job
Malaysia
Kuala Lumpur
6-8 years

a month ago

Permanent Job
Malaysia
Kuala Lumpur
6-8 years

a month ago

Permanent Job
Malaysia
4-5 years

a month ago

Permanent Job
Malaysia
2-3 years

a month ago

Permanent Job
Malaysia
1-3 years

a month ago